What is one primary design purpose of stone check dams?

The primary design purpose of stone check dams is to reduce the velocity of water flow in a channel. When constructed, these check dams create a series of barriers that slow down the movement of water, which helps minimize erosion along stream banks and in the channel itself. By reducing the flow velocity, these structures allow sediment to settle out, which can help improve water quality and prevent sediment transport downstream.

While trapping and filtering sediment are important functions that check dams can serve, the primary intention with their design is focused on velocity reduction. This reduction is crucial for maintaining the stability of surrounding areas and ensuring that sediment does not wash away too quickly, which could lead to further erosion issues. Therefore, recognizing the role of stone check dams in controlling water speed is essential for understanding their function in erosion and sediment control practices.
